铋镓共掺的高浓度掺铒石英基光纤中铒离子团簇率的实验研究

摘    要:使用MCVD法结合溶液掺杂技术制作了铒铋镓共掺的石英基光纤.根据光纤吸收谱,得出其中铒离子浓度是5.24×1025/m3.然后提出了一种新的利用透射率测定掺铒光纤的团簇率的实验方法,该方法相比于以前的方法更简单有效.利用该方法,测得了自制铒铋镓共掺光纤中团簇率.通过与前人的结果相比较,充分说明铋和镓的掺入大大提高了铒离子在石英基光纤中的溶解度,抑制了铒离子形成团簇.关键词:掺铒光纤石英基光纤团簇高浓度

Experimental research on the degree of clustering in Bi3+-Ga3+ co-doped high concentration Er3+-doped silica-based fiber

Abstract:In order to obtain high-concentration doped erbium ions in silica-based fiber, we manufactured Er3+-Bi3+-Ga3+ co-doped fiber using MCVD and solution doping technique. The concentration of Er3+ in the fiber was about 5.24×1025/m3. We described a new method to measure the degree of clustering in the Er3+-Bi3+-Ga3+ co-doped fiber using fiber transmission experiment. Compared with other methods, the new method is simpler and more accurate. By the new method, the degree of clustering in Er3+-Bi3+-Ga3+ co-doped fiber was determined. It was shown that co-doped Bi3+-Ga3+ strongly increased the Er3+ solubility in the silica-based fiber.
